Big Boy Restaurants Begins Construction Of Next Generation Prototype Store Design

GRAND RAPIDS (Monday, June 10, 2002) - Today, Big Boy Restaurants International LLC began a whole new chapter in its long and illustrious history at 407 Pearl Street N.W. in Grand Rapids, Michigan. The company broke ground as a prelude to construction on a new prototype Big Boy restaurant. This new concept will set the design standard for company- and franchise-owned stores across the nation.
"Grand Rapids has always been an excellent market for Big Boy Restaurants and we want to continue to be part of the city's dynamic growth," said Tony Michaels, CEO of Big Boy Restaurants International LLC.

Currently, an existing company-owned Big Boy restaurant sits on the Pearl Street site and will be razed once the new prototype store is completed sometime in December 2002. Actual construction is expected to start in July 2002. This will allow the company to test new ideas and concepts with a large range of age groups.

Designed to remember the past, yet embrace the future, the new Big Boy prototype restaurant will incorporate new materials and efficient design concepts all aimed at improving customer service. From the dynamic yet inviting use of brick and tile outside to the multiple floor coverings and large windows letting in natural light on the inside, the new prototype Big Boy store will be as warm and friendly as the Big Boy icon himself.

"Through the years we have never forgotten two things at Big Boy: the quality of the food and the importance of customer service. This new Big Boy prototype restaurant updates our store design and allow us to provide better service to our customers, young and old alike," said Michaels.

With over approximately 4,400 square feet of floor space, the new Big Boy prototype restaurant will seat up to 150 customers. As customers enter the brightly lit entranceway, they will be struck with the openness of the new design. There will be a Big Boy ice cream counter to sit at as well as a dedicated retail shop that will carry Big Boy packaged foods including ground coffee, salad dressings, cookies and water.

Louis & Partners, Bath, Ohio, conceived the new Big Boy prototype restaurant design. Their charge from Tony Michaels and others at Big Boy was to design a restaurant that capitalized all that was good about the Big Boy experience while improving the look and feel of both outside and inside spaces.

"We asked Louis & Partners to start with a blank sheet of paper and improve on everything we did. The interior design is outstanding, giving customers a one-of-a-kind Big Boy dining experience," said Michaels. "And, our professional operations team worked with them to redesign the kitchen area for greater operational efficiency which leads to better customer service. This new design costs less to build and that, together with the design innovations, should be very appealing to prospective franchise developers," Michaels added.

The new Big Boy prototype restaurant will be built in the parking lot of the existing Pearl Street Big Boy restaurant. When the new restaurant is completed, the old one will be razed and a new parking lot constructed. No jobs will be lost during construction or after the new restaurant opens.

Headquartered in Warren, Mich., Big Boy Restaurants International LLC is the exclusive worldwide franchiser of more than 455 Big Boy Restaurants in the United States, Japan and Egypt.
